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Bohol, Philippines
The Chocolate Hills
These iconic, cone-shaped hills turn a rich brown during the dry season, hence the name. It's a truly unforgettable sight, best viewed from a scenic viewpoint. Getting there is easy using local transport options.
Tarsier Sanctuary
See the adorable, tiny tarsiers – these nocturnal primates are unique to the Philippines. Remember to be respectful of their habitat and follow the sanctuary's guidelines.
Alona Beach
Relax on the white sands of Alona Beach, swim in the turquoise waters, or enjoy watersports. It's a popular spot, but you can still find quieter corners to unwind.
Loboc River
Take a relaxing boat trip down the Loboc River, enjoying the lush scenery and maybe even a delicious lunch on board. This is a great way to experience the natural beauty of Bohol.

Best Zones & Areas to Explore in Bohol, Philippines
- Alona Beach: The main tourist hub, perfect for those who like a lively atmosphere.
- Anda Beach: Quieter and more secluded, ideal for relaxation and escaping the crowds.
- Carmen: Home to the Chocolate Hills, offering stunning viewpoints.
- Loboc: Known for its river cruise and lush scenery.

Best Time to Visit Bohol, Philippines
The best time to visit Bohol is during the dry season (November to May). However, even during the wet season (June to October), you can still enjoy your trip, just be prepared for some rain showers.
Transportation Options in Bohol, Philippines
Getting around Bohol is relatively easy. You can use local buses, rent a motorbike, or hire a tricycle (a three-wheeled vehicle). Traveloka can assist with car rentals for greater flexibility.
